Design And Development Of Micro:bit Interactive Robot Teaching Project For Primary School Students

With the advancement and integration of informatization and industrialization,robot technology has become one of the important indicators to measure the ability of scientific and technological innovation,and has attracted wide attention from all walks of life.Robot education had set off a wave of learning upsurge as its modules such as "Robot Design and Manufacture" and "Open Source Hardware Project Design" being included in the compulsory curriculum of General High School Curriculum Program and Course Standards for Chinese and Other Disciplines(2017 Edition)by the Ministry of Education in 2018.However,in the specific practice process,due to the excessive use of traditional teaching methods and the lack of lively and interesting teaching projects,students' learning interest and participation are not high enough.In this study,based on micro: bit,an open source hardware platform,combining the learning characteristics of primary school students,integrating STEAM education concept and interesting interactive teaching mode,a number of interactive robot teaching projects for primary school students have been designed and developed,and some good teaching results in practice have been achieved.The purpose of this paper is to stimulate students' interest and confidence by increasing the extensibility and interaction of robotic teaching resources.The main contents of this paper are as follows:(1)The research status of robot education and micro:bit at home and abroad is analyzed and elaborated,and the research direction is determined.The concepts of robots,educational robots and robot education,interactive robots,etc.are clarified.The micro:bit and its characteristics are introduced.Then it summarizes STEAM education,project-based teaching method,interesting interactive teaching mode and constructivist learning theory,which lays a theoretical foundation for this paper's study.(2)On the basis of fully considering the psychological and thinking characteristics of primary school students,guided by the recommendations of Basic Education Information Technology Curriculum Standard(2012 edition)for the moduleof "Introduction to Robots",and centering on six principles of education,science,interest,novelty,practicability and STEAM education,the objectives and contents of interactive robot teaching project for primary students are determined.(3)Based on the interesting interactive teaching mode and the stronger connection with science,technology,engineering,art and mathematics,an interactive robot teaching model integrating STEAM education concept is designed.(4)Twelve vivid and interesting teaching projects including "Simple MP3 Player","Intelligent Nightlight" and "Simple Radio Telegraph" were designed and developed,and applied to the teaching practice of a robot education center in Yudong,Banan District,Chongqing.Finally,in view of the use effect of the designed teaching project,a questionnaire survey was conducted among the students and an interview was conducted with the teachers.Questionnaire survey and interview results show the application value of the micro: bit interactive robot teaching project designed for primary school students in this paper.Because of its elementary,this research is going to provide a reference for more design and development of micro:bit and interactive robot teaching projects.
